MacBook Neo confirms support for individual keyboard replacement

Technology outlet MacRumors published a blog post, reporting that, based on the repair manuals posted on Apple’s official website, the MacBook Neo confirms support for replacing the keyboard component separately. This design breaks Apple’s long-standing hardware bundling and repair practice, greatly improving the device’s reparability. For many years, if users needed to replace a MacBook keyboard, Apple required that it be replaced together with the entire aluminum top case (Top Case).
